summ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Bruce Beare <brucex.j.beare@intel.com>2010-10-11 10:51:38 -0700
committerBruce Beare <brucex.j.beare@intel.com>2010-10-11 10:51:38 -0700
commitc2dcefa3822e31ccb85644311b9df52ca541cf04 (patch)
tree3528b663bdc497f0f916823d02495120c07df587
parent05af2c4a2b799455a8b6328bf89fdc13abba1b4f (diff)
downloaddiskinstaller-c2dcefa3822e31ccb85644311b9df52ca541cf04.tar.gz
Make the /system/bin/sh link so installer.c works.
The recent change to system/core/sh (bdc36d6) broke installer.c. This is easily fixed by restoring /system/bin/sh as a symlink to ash. Change-Id: Ie401adc4403faec0254169f9453aaf8bcbb37820 Signed-off-by: Bruce Beare <brucex.j.beare@intel.com>
-rw-r--r--config.mk2
-rw-r--r--init.rc1
2 files changed, 2 insertions, 1 deletions
diff --git a/config.mk b/config.mk
index 11f17fc..c01d188 100644
--- a/config.mk
+++ b/config.mk
@@ -12,7 +12,7 @@ android_sysbase_modules := \
libm \
libstdc++ \
linker \
- sh \
+ ash \
toolbox \
logcat \
gdbserver \
diff --git a/init.rc b/init.rc
index 48cf3ca..5ba0f18 100644
--- a/init.rc
+++ b/init.rc
@@ -4,6 +4,7 @@ on init
export ANDROID_DATA /data
symlink /system/etc /etc
+ symlink /system/bin/ash /system/bin/sh
mkdir /data
mkdir /cache